The University of Maryland, Baltimore County (UMBC) is a public research university in Baltimore County, Maryland. It is part of the University System of Maryland and is known for its strong programs in the natural and social sciences, engineering, and public policy. UMBC has a diverse and inclusive campus community and is recognized for its commitment to undergraduate teaching and research.

UMBC offers a wide range of academic programs, including undergraduate majors, master's programs, and doctoral programs. The university is particularly well-regarded for its STEM (science, technology, engineering, and mathematics) fields, but it also has strong programs in the humanities, arts, and social sciences.

The university's campus is located in a suburban setting, providing a balance between a traditional college environment and access to the resources of a major metropolitan area. UMBC's campus features modern facilities for research, learning, and recreation.

UMBC is also known for its commitment to community engagement and social responsibility. The university encourages students to participate in service-learning and volunteer opportunities, and it has partnerships with local organizations and businesses.

In terms of research, UMBC is classified as a Research University with High Research Activity (R2) by the Carnegie Classification of Institutions of Higher Education. This reflects the university's significant research output and the impact of its research in various fields.

Overall, UMBC is considered a reputable and respected institution, particularly in the areas of science, engineering, and technology.
